Related: Editorials & Other Articles, Issue Forums, Alliance Forums, Region ForumsFerguson Police Chief to step down today, announcement forthcoming, says news.
BREAKING:
Fox News is reporting, via sources, that Ferguson, Mo., Police Chief Tom Jackson will resign today following the Department of Justice report. CNN is reporting that Jackson has indicated he is willing to step down, but does not mention timing. The police department has not made any announcement. -
